Right Now (Part 1)

Right now, I'm sitting here writing this rhyme, As I do it, millions of people are abused by time, God knows I would help them if I truely could, There are many people I'm sure who also would. Right now, little Timmy is waiting for a willing organ doner, None of the kids in his school care, he's always been a loner, The doctor says the prognosis doesn't look very good, His parents hope he won't die, and he's wishing he would. Right now, some homeless bum is running down the street, Running from the man that he hoped he never would meet, This man wants to try something with his brand new gun, Funny how theres such a thin line between fear and fun. Right now, someone is spending their paycheck to fix their car, They have to have it, to walk to their job is simply much too far, Now they can't even buy food because all their money is spent, What will happen at the end of the month when they can't pay rent? Right now, someone is playing slots in Vegas trying, hoping to hit it big, That someone is so poor they can barely afford to puff on that second hand cig, They know that if they get lucky and become the big winner, They might know for once what its like to have a real dinner. Right now, some girl is sitting in her empty apartment, Wondering just where her fiance of 11 months went, He said he'd be right back, he was just going to the store, Now she knows that the bastard doesn't love her anymore. Right now, some superstar is walking all alone to his car, He is looking around wondering where his bodyguards are, A beggar asks him for money, knowing his life this superstar can affect, The superstar shoves him away scattering the $0.05 the bum wanted to protect. Right now, a mother is going through her labor pain, Kicking and screaming at her family Doctor DeWayne, Doctor DeWayne says it will be either the baby or the mother. And now a husband quietly says goodbye to his significant other.
